Today is Free Entrance Day at national parks, in case you didn't know. It's not too late to skip out on work (I won't tell anyone), and head on out to the nearest national park. Tomorrow though, forest service employees will be attending a classroom training on Wednesday, June 22nd. That means some Idaho-Panhandle National Forests' offices will be closed for business.

Get Hoopfest Mobile!
Tracking your schedule and your favorite players at Hoopfest is set to become a lot easier this year, thanks to Hoopfest Mobile. The site, introduced for the first time this year, allows you to follow your bracket, track any player and find your court with your cell phone.

Until now, you'd have to go to the court to find out when you were playing. The other option: fight the crowds at the bracket boards at Riverfront Park. With tens of thousands of people lining downtown streets, you know the task can be quite time consuming and downright annoying.

New Sunscreen Rules

Next time you go to buy sunscreen, there may be more to read on the label!

Federal regulators will soon require sunscreen manufacturers to test their products' effectiveness against sun rays that pose the greatest risk of skin cancer.

Kick-Off Summer With A Free Visit To A National Park!

Start summer with a free visit to a national park! 

The National Park Service is waiving all entrance fees on June 21 – the first day of summer.

Additional fee free days in 2011 are National Public Lands Day (Saturday, September 24) and Veterans Day weekend (November 11-13).

Route of the Hiawatha Opens Saturday!

Pump up the bike tires and grab your helmet - one of the Inland Northwest's favorite trail rides, the Route of the Hiawatha, opens Saturday!

The June 11th opening actually marks a delay in the trail's typical season. The route usually opens from May to September, but the cool spring and heavy snowfall delayed the opening. Crews from Lookout Pass, which operates the trail, have been clearing the snow from the trailhead's highest peak to get ready for this weekend.
